Wholesale Organically Modified Phyllosilicate Bentonite
Product Details
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Appearance | Cream-colored powder |
Bulk Density | 550-750 kg/m³ |
pH (2% suspension) | 9-10 |
Specific Density | 2.3g/cm³ |
Common Product Specifications
Specification | Details |
---|---|
Use Level | 0.1-3.0% in total formulation |
Packaging | 25kgs/pack, HDPE bags or cartons |
Storage | Dry area, 0-30°C, unopened |
Product Manufacturing Process
Based on authoritative research, organically modified phyllosilicates are produced through methods involving ion exchange and covalent grafting. These processes replace natural inorganic cations with organic cations, typically quaternary ammonium compounds, enhancing compatibility with organic matrices. This modification improves the dispersal of phyllosilicates in polymer matrices, leading to advanced composite materials with superior mechanical and thermal properties.
Product Application Scenarios
Organically modified phyllosilicates are widely applied in the coatings industry, offering enhanced suspension and thixotropic properties. They are also used in polymer nanocomposites for automotive, aerospace, and packaging industries due to their excellent barrier properties and mechanical reinforcement. These materials are pivotal in developing low-permeability coatings essential for moisture and gas-resistant packaging.

- Organically Modified Phyllosilicates in Environmental Remediation Beyond industrial applications, organically modified phyllosilicates are gaining recognition for their role in environmental sustainability, particularly in water purification. Their capacity to adsorb organic pollutants, enhance filtration systems, and reduce pollution makes them a vital tool in environmental management and protection strategies.
